A proper s54 swap is going to be 7k or more. A s54 is 3-4K . Rod bearings, vanos fixes, oil pump chain, and other knickknacks 1,500-2k . Labor 1,200 to 3k. Proper exhaust 600-1200. Pnp swap parts 500-900.
Hello get the picture?
You sell the s52 for 1,500-2,500

Have you ever priced out engine work on an S52? $10k and you'll still be at least 50hp short of that stock S54 with an exhaust and the right tune. And you'll have a motor that probably will have a fraction of the lifespan of that used S54. And when that S54 blows up, you can find a replacement and swap it out in a weekend. When that S52 blows up, well, gotta find a hole in your engine builder's schedule and another $10k, and you'll get your car back on the road 6-12 months later.

LOL I would submit it isn't "hard", it's expensive. 😜
I mean I feel like it wouldn't be far off. You'd probably spend $3.5-4.5k on the head including cams. Probably hard to get a good header these days? But let's say you get one, maybe $1k. HFM, Big Bore throttle body, adding an intake, Maybe like another $1k or so plus exhaust.. Plus the refresh of your head gasket, studs, anything else there. And depends on who's doing the work. DIY would of course save money... as usual. But I'd say for sure a high-hp S52 build probably wouldn't be much cheaper than S54, especially given the results would be very different, you can't rev as high, it'll be highly modified and high strung. And anything that breaks will be 'modified' so you'll have to replace as such.
I think the S54 is a much more sensible option... yes it costs more, but it is meant to live at the power levels it produces, so it 'should' be a safer more reliable motor.

It’s expensive to build an S54. A used one might be comparable to building an S52, but when you have to maintain and repair the S54 you will spend more. Valves need periodic adjustment, vanos has more expensive issues. I fully built an S52. Have about $4k in the bottom end and about $4500 in the top end. Plus the turbo system, driveshaft, transmission, clutch, differential, axles.... it would have cost more if I did all this to an S54.
